Answer:

Apostrophe

Explanation:

The apostrophe is a figure of speech easier to identify, since it is revealed through the vocative, that is, it is the figure of the call, of the invocation. The apostrophe can appear in several types of text, including in poems, but the identification of its classification as a figure of language is the same, regardless of the type of text.
